SCOTTSDALE, Ariz. — As the Carolina Panthers and Denver Broncos prepare for Super Bowl 50 this weekend, William McGirt returns to PGA Tour action at the Waste Management Phoenix Open.

The Fairmont native and Wofford alum will have his eyes on the big game this Sunday, but first, he’ll look to bounce back from his worst finish of the season, a missed cut two weeks ago at the CareerBuilder Challenge.

“I had a pretty good week off,” McGirt told The Robesonian. “I got to spend some time with the family and had plenty of time to practice. Hopefully, I worked out some of the kinks and will be ready to go this week.”

Currently 27th in the FedEx Cup standings, McGirt looks to get back to how he was playing in his first four starts, which resulted in a pair of top-10 finishes.

He’ll tee off today at 1:40 p.m. EST on No. 1 with Jeff Overton and N.C. State alum Carl Pettersson.

Dubbed “The Greatest Show on Grass,” the Phoenix Open is hosted by TPC Scottsdale and features the rowdy par-3 16th hole, known as the loudest hole in golf.

“The course is perfect right now,” he said.

McGirt’s best finish at the event came in 2014 (19th). In three other appearances, he finished 22nd, 30th and 32nd. The tie for 30th came last season after rounds of 67, 71, 74 and 67 led to a 5-under-par performance.

Brooks Koepka is the defending champion of the event. The second-year pro wasted no time capturing his first Tour title when he shot a final-round 66 to win by a stroke in his first start at TPC Scottsdale.

As for the Super Bowl, McGirt is rolling with Carolina. It comes as no surprise since Panthers owner Jerry Richardson, team president Danny Morrison and wide receiver Brenton Bersin are Wofford grads.

“I have to go with the Panthers,” he said. “I would be pulling for Denver just to see Peyton (Manning) go out on top if they were playing anyone else. With a lot of connections to the the Panthers, I’m 100 percent behind them.”

The score?

“I’m gonna say 31-17,” McGirt said.
